Introduction to Wet Grinding Machines
Wet grinding machines play a pivotal role in modern manufacturing and material processing by enabling ultra-fine particle size reduction while preserving material integrity and chemical stability. These systems, which range from wet ball mill designs to specialized wet milling machine platforms, are engineered to handle diverse feedstocks including pigments, ceramics, minerals, and foodstuffs, delivering consistent dispersion and narrow particle size distributions. Choosing the right wet grinding machine depends on throughput requirements, target particle size, feed characteristics and downstream process compatibility, and decision-makers must evaluate equipment based on energy efficiency, maintenance profile and scale-up reliability. Advantages of Wet Grinding Technology
Wet grinding offers clear advantages over dry milling in applications where heat-sensitive components, oxidation risk or agglomeration are concerns, because the liquid medium suppresses temperature rise and stabilizes particle surfaces during milling. In many pigment and coating formulations, a wet grinding ball mill achieves superior color strength, gloss and rheological properties compared with dry alternatives, delivering improved final product performance and higher production yields. Additionally, wet ball mill configurations and wet milling machine setups allow for easier scale-up from laboratory to production through predictable energy-per-ton metrics and straightforward parameter translation such as media size, mill speed and slurry solids content. When assessing total cost of ownership, companies often find wet grinding machines reduce rework, lower waste generation and enable formulation innovations that would be difficult or impossible with dry processes. Finally, wet grinding provides flexibility to process a wide range of product classes, from ceramic powders and battery materials to pharmaceutical intermediates and food ingredients like rice flours produced by rice stone grinder systems.

Applications and Industries Served
Wet grinding machines are used across a spectrum of industries, including coatings and pigments, ink manufacturing, pharmaceuticals, chemical intermediates, ceramics, mineral processing, battery materials and food processing, where precise particle size and dispersion quality are essential to product performance. In coatings and ink production, wet ball mill and wet grinding ball mill equipment produce highly dispersed pigment concentrates that improve color strength, stability and application properties. The pharmaceutical sector relies on wet milling machines to create controlled particle size distributions that improve bioavailability and ensure consistent dissolution profiles. Ceramics and advanced materials manufacturers use our vertical and horizontal sand mill variants to produce high-purity powders with controlled morphology, while battery material producers leverage wet milling to achieve uniform particle distribution critical to electrochemical performance.
